Subordinate Clause: Simple Rules You Need to Know | Grammarly 23.12.2020 · If it was written separately as a sentence, the result would be a sentence fragment—your English teacher’s pet peeve. If I can find my wallet. What will happen if I can find my wallet? If a clause in your sentence leaves us hanging like this when set apart on its own, it is a subordinate clause. Words that begin subordinate clauses. Dependent and independent clauses (video) | Khan Academy So with all that out of the way. Let's start with independent clauses, because an independent clause is basically a sentence. We established previously that all a clause is is just a collection of phrases with a subject and a verb. So, for example, the sentence, I ate the pineapple, period, is an independent clause.

Compound Sentence Examples to Better Understand Their Use Constructing a Compound Sentence. Each half of a compound sentence must stand on its own as a complete sentence. That means each half needs a subject and a verb. For example: I want the sporty red car, but I will lease the practical blue one. In the sentence above, the subjects are italicized and the verbs are in bold.
